public void CanPatchUnrelatedTypes() {
            dynamic delta = new Delta<SimpleMessageA>();
            delta.Data = "Blah";

            var msg = new SimpleMessageB {
                Data = "Blah2"
            };
            delta.Patch(msg);

            Assert.Equal(delta.Data, msg.Data);
        }
Exemple #2
0
    public void CanPatchUnrelatedTypes()
    {
        dynamic delta = new Delta <SimpleMessageA>();

        delta.Data = "Blah";

        var msg = new SimpleMessageB {
            Data = "Blah2"
        };

        delta.Patch(msg);

        Assert.Equal(delta.Data, msg.Data);
    }